Understanding Behavioral Challenges in Autism
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) affects how a child communicates, interacts, and regulates emotions. Behavioral difficulties may arise from frustration, sensory overload, or changes in routine — and can vary widely from one child to another.
Common challenges include:
- Meltdowns or emotional outbursts
- Rigid routines or resistance to change
- Self-injurious or repetitive behaviors
- Difficulty communicating needs or understanding others
- Anxiety or distress in social situations
- Sleep and eating disruptions
Recognizing the why behind behaviors allows families and clinicians to respond with empathy rather than discipline.
When to Seek Professional Support
Consider a psychiatric consultation if your child:
- Has frequent emotional outbursts that are hard to calm
- Struggles with daily transitions or new environments
- Becomes anxious or distressed in social or sensory settings
- Shows aggressive or self-harming behaviors
- Has difficulty sleeping or maintaining routines
- Experiences sudden changes in behavior or mood
Specialized care can reduce distress for both the child and the family, improving quality of life at home and school.
